package com.google.gerrit.server.change;
import com.google.common.base.MoreObjects;
import com.google.common.collect.Lists;
import com.google.gerrit.common.data.SubmitRecord;
import com.google.gerrit.extensions.common.AccountInfo;
import com.google.gerrit.extensions.common.TestSubmitRuleInput;
import com.google.gerrit.extensions.common.TestSubmitRuleInput.Filters;
import com.google.gerrit.extensions.restapi.AuthException;
import com.google.gerrit.extensions.restapi.RestModifyView;
import com.google.gerrit.reviewdb.server.ReviewDb;
import com.google.gerrit.rules.RulesCache;
import com.google.gerrit.server.account.AccountLoader;
import com.google.gerrit.server.project.SubmitRuleEvaluator;
import com.google.gerrit.server.query.change.ChangeData;
import com.google.gwtorm.server.OrmException;
import com.google.inject.Inject;
import com.google.inject.Provider;
import java.util.LinkedHashMap;
import java.util.List;
import java.util.Map;
import org.kohsuke.args4j.Option;
public class TestSubmitRule implements RestModifyView<RevisionResource, TestSubmitRuleInput> {
private final Provider<ReviewDb> db;
private final ChangeData.Factory changeDataFactory;
private final RulesCache rules;
private final AccountLoader.Factory accountInfoFactory;
private final SubmitRuleEvaluator.Factory submitRuleEvaluatorFactory;
@Option(name = "--filters", usage = "impact of filters in parent projects")
private Filters filters = Filters.RUN;
@Inject
TestSubmitRule(
Provider<ReviewDb> db,
ChangeData.Factory changeDataFactory,
RulesCache rules,
AccountLoader.Factory infoFactory,
SubmitRuleEvaluator.Factory submitRuleEvaluatorFactory) {
this.db = db;
this.changeDataFactory = changeDataFactory;
this.rules = rules;
this.accountInfoFactory = infoFactory;
this.submitRuleEvaluatorFactory = submitRuleEvaluatorFactory;
}
@Override
public List<Record> apply(RevisionResource rsrc, TestSubmitRuleInput input)
throws AuthException, OrmException {
if (input == null) {
input = new TestSubmitRuleInput();
}
if (input.rule != null && !rules.isProjectRulesEnabled()) {
throw new AuthException("project rules are disabled");
}
input.filters = MoreObjects.firstNonNull(input.filters, filters);
SubmitRuleEvaluator evaluator =
submitRuleEvaluatorFactory.create(
rsrc.getUser(), changeDataFactory.create(db.get(), rsrc.getNotes()));
List<SubmitRecord> records =
evaluator
.setPatchSet(rsrc.getPatchSet())
.setLogErrors(false)
.setSkipSubmitFilters(input.filters == Filters.SKIP)
.setRule(input.rule)
.evaluate();
List<Record> out = Lists.newArrayListWithCapacity(records.size());
AccountLoader accounts = accountInfoFactory.create(true);
for (SubmitRecord r : records) {
out.add(new Record(r, accounts));
}
if (!out.isEmpty()) {
out.get(0).prologReductionCount = evaluator.getReductionsConsumed();
}
accounts.fill();
return out;
}
static class Record {
SubmitRecord.Status status;
String errorMessage;
Map<String, AccountInfo> ok;
Map<String, AccountInfo> reject;
Map<String, None> need;
Map<String, AccountInfo> may;
Map<String, None> impossible;
Long prologReductionCount;
Record(SubmitRecord r, AccountLoader accounts) {
this.status = r.status;
this.errorMessage = r.errorMessage;
if (r.labels != null) {
for (SubmitRecord.Label n : r.labels) {
AccountInfo who = n.appliedBy != null ? accounts.get(n.appliedBy) : new AccountInfo(null);
label(n, who);
}
}
}
private void label(SubmitRecord.Label n, AccountInfo who) {
switch (n.status) {
case OK:
if (ok == null) {
ok = new LinkedHashMap<>();
}
ok.put(n.label, who);
break;
case REJECT:
if (reject == null) {
reject = new LinkedHashMap<>();
}
reject.put(n.label, who);
break;
case NEED:
if (need == null) {
need = new LinkedHashMap<>();
}
need.put(n.label, new None());
break;
case MAY:
if (may == null) {
may = new LinkedHashMap<>();
}
may.put(n.label, who);
break;
case IMPOSSIBLE:
if (impossible == null) {
impossible = new LinkedHashMap<>();
}
impossible.put(n.label, new None());
break;
}
}
}
static class None {}
}
